Original text and translations

Latin.png Latin text

Adóro te devóte, látens Déitas, Que sub his figúris vere látitas: Tíbi se cor méum tótum súbjicit, Quia te contémplans tótum déficit. Amen.


German.png German translation

Ich bete dich an demütig, verborgene Gottheit, die unter diesen Gestalten wahrhaft verborgen ist. Dir unterwirft sich mein Herz ganz, weil es, dich schauend, ganz vergeht. Amen.
